摘要: 一.1.获取数据源2.DataTable dt = st.Tables[0]; HttpResponse resp; // HTTP响应信息 resp = Page.Response; resp.ContentEncoding = System.Text... 阅读全文
posted @ 2014-04-22 15:40 LXJ5 阅读(194) 评论(0) 推荐(0) 编辑
摘要: 1.未在本地计算机上注册“Microsoft.Jet.OLEDB.4.0”提供程序。解决方案:在IIS上打开该网站应用程序池-->高级设置-->启动32位程序-->选True 阅读全文
posted @ 2013-12-30 16:02 LXJ5 阅读(133) 评论(0) 推荐(0) 编辑
摘要: 一.首先来看一下最基本的数据访问程序,下面以"新增用户"和"得到用户"为例.1.实体用户类代码如下,假设只有ID和Nane两个字段:public class User { public int Uid { get; set; } public string Name { get; set; } }2.sqlserverUser类---用于操作User类,代码如下:public class SqlserverUser { public void Insert(User user) { Console.WriteLine("在SQL Server中 阅读全文
posted @ 2013-08-04 15:27 LXJ5 阅读(326) 评论(0) 推荐(0) 编辑
摘要: 在ASP.NET的WebForm组件中的LinkButton组件也是一个服务器端的组件,这个组件有点类似于HTML中的<A>标识符。它的主要作用是就是在ASP.NET页面中显示一个超链接。当这个链接被按动的时候,页面就会往服务器端传递信息,并且在服务器端来处理相应的事件。一.属性1.Text :LinkButton组件显示的文字2.CommandName,CommandArgument 这二个属性在功能上基本相同,当Click事件被触发的时候,通过这二个属性可以方便的往服务器端传递数据。二.用法:1.在程序中给LinkButton的CommandName属性和CommandArgument属性 阅读全文
posted @ 2013-07-12 03:06 LXJ5 阅读(993) 评论(0) 推荐(0) 编辑
摘要: 图一图二比如将图一中是否显示中的列显示以图二中的方式显示:方法1:1.在后台编写方法:a.aspx.cs代码如下 //IsShow字段显示的方法public string GetStrIsShow(int show){ if(show==1) { return "是"; } else { return "否"; } }2.在前台绑定该方法:a.aspx代码如下 //参数IsShow为绑定字段,也就是实体类中的属性------------------------------------------------------------------------ 阅读全文
posted @ 2013-07-04 17:38 LXJ5 阅读(246) 评论(0) 推荐(0) 编辑
摘要: 一.Cookie对象:1.Cookie是由网络服务器发送出来,存在在浏览器上,它是个存储在浏览器目录中的文本文件。当浏览该cookie对应的站点时,cookie作为http头部文件的一部分在浏览器和服务器之间互相传递,这些数据和传递过程对于用户是不直接可见的。2.cookie对象为web应用程序保存用户的相关信息提供了一种有效的方法,它分别属于Request对象和Response对象,每一个Cookie对属于集合Cookies,所以访问cookie可以通过索引器的方式访问。3.Cookie的语法:Response.Cookies[cookie的名称].Value=变量值。 //写入Cookie 阅读全文
posted @ 2013-07-01 23:12 LXJ5 阅读(635) 评论(0) 推荐(0) 编辑
摘要: 一.系统提供了许多泛型类和泛型接口,List和Dictionary是常用的泛型类。 IComparable是最常用的泛型接口.二.IComparable和IComparer接口区别:1.IComparable在要比较的对象的类中实现,可以比较该对象和另一个对象;2.IComparer在一个单独的类中实现,可以比较任意两个对象。如下示例可以看出它们之间的区别:1.实现IComparable接口代码:publicclassStudent:IComparable{privatestringname;publicstringName{get{returnname;}set{name=value;}}p 阅读全文
posted @ 2013-06-29 22:19 LXJ5 阅读(268) 评论(0) 推荐(0) 编辑
摘要: 一.c#中继承分为实现继承和接口继承两种:1.实现继承:表示一个类型派生于一个基类,这个类拥有基类所有的成员字段和函数。在实现继承中,派生类型采用基类的每个函数的实现代码,除非在派生类型的定义中指定重写某个函数的实现代码。在需要给现有的类型添加功能,或者多相关的类型共享一组重要的公共功能时,这种类型的继承是非常有用的。c#中每个类只可以继承一个基类。2.接口继承:表示一个类型只继承函数的签名,没有继承任何实现代码。在需要指定该类型具有某些可用的特性时,最好使用这种类型的继承。c#中每个类可以实现多个接口。二.结构和类的继承:1.结构派生自System.ValueType,它不支持实现继承,但支 阅读全文
posted @ 2013-06-27 14:35 LXJ5 阅读(242) 评论(0) 推荐(0) 编辑
摘要: 1.eg(num):查找索引num位置的元素,索引从0开始。2.lt(num):查找索引小于num位置的元素,索引从0开始。3.gt(num):查找索引大于num位置的元素,索引从0开始。示例: 1 2 3 4实现:$("li:eq(2)").css("background", "red"); //找到第三个元素并改变背景色,索引从0开始$("#france li:lt(2)").css("background", "red"); //找到id为france下元素索引小于2的 阅读全文
posted @ 2013-06-24 23:59 LXJ5 阅读(194) 评论(0) 推荐(0) 编辑
摘要: 1.枚举概念:枚举是用户定义的整型类型,在声明一个枚举时,要指定该枚举的实例可以包含的一组可接受的值,还可以给值指定易于记忆的名称。如果在代码的某个地方,要试图把一个不可接受范围内的值赋予枚举的一个实例,编译就会出错。2.枚举的优点:(1)枚举可以使代码易于维护,有助于确保给变量指定合法的,期望的值。(2)枚举使代码更清晰,允许用描述的名称表示整数值,而不是用含义模糊,变化多端的数来表示。(3)枚举能使代码易于键入。示例://定义一个枚举public enum TimeOfDay { Morning=0, Afternoon=1, Evening=2 }//函数主入口 static void. 阅读全文
posted @ 2013-06-24 16:46 LXJ5 阅读(397) 评论(0) 推荐(1) 编辑